quadrilineatus, Labrus Rüppell [W. P. E. S.] 1835:6, Pl. 2 (fig. 1) [Neue Wirbelthiere zu der Fauna von Abyssinien gehörig. Fische des Rothen Meeres; ref. 3844] Massawa, Eritrea, Red Sea. Neotype: BMNH 1845.10.29.105. Former syntypes: SMF 1588 (4, missing). Neotype designated by Tea et al. 2026:415 [ref. 43076]. •Valid as Larabicus quadrilineatus (Rüppell 1835) -- (Dor 1984:204 [ref. 29757], Goren & Dor 1994:54 [ref. 25356], Parenti & Randall 2000:29 [ref. 24943], Manilo & Bogorodsky 2003:S115 [ref. 27377], Kuiter 2010:360 [ref. 35285], Golani & Fricke 2018:127 [ref. 36273], Eagderi et al. 2019:73 [ref. 37020], Zajonz et al. 2019:90 [ref. 36871], Randall & Victor 2022:223 [ref. 39916], Chaikin & Belmaker 2026:38 [ref. 42733], Golani & Fricke 2026:152 [ref. 42831]). •Valid as Labroides quadrilineatus (Rüppell 1835) -- (Near et al. 2025:272 [ref. 42466], Tea et al. 2026:414 [ref. 43076]). Current status: Valid as Labroides quadrilineatus (Rüppell 1835). Labridae: Julidinae. Distribution: Red Sea endemic: Gulf of Aqaba to Gulf of Aden, Socotra (Yemen). IUCN (2010): Data Deficient. Habitat: marine.
